KYC verification is required before your first withdrawal, with a government photo ID, proof of address and proof of payment method requested as part of standard checks β and player reports indicate this can take several weeks here, so it's wise to submit clear documents straight after registering rather than waiting until you want to cash out. The connection is protected with 128-bit SSL encryption, a strong unique password helps keep your account safe, and you should avoid logging in on shared devices and only ever use the official domain.

One point worth being upfront about: True Fortune is an offshore casino. It points to a Curaçao licence (reviews cite number 8048/JAZ), but that status is unverified β there's no clickable validator seal, and AskGamblers has blacklisted the operator over licensing concerns β so verify it yourself on the official site rather than assuming. It isn't ACMA-approved, so while using offshore casinos isn't a criminal offence for individual Australian players, local consumer protections don't apply and dispute-resolution options may be limited. Treat play as higher-risk.
